Understanding Clio Keys

Renault Clio keys come in numerous designs, including traditional metal keys, key fobs, and clever keys. The type of key your Clio has will affect the replacement procedure, so it's necessary to know which type you own. Below is a quick introduction of the various key types:

Key TypeDescriptionReplacement Cost
Conventional KeyAn easy metal key with no electronic elements.₤ 10 - ₤ 50
Key FobA key with a built-in remote for locking/unlocking doors.₤ 50 - ₤ 150
Smart KeyA key that allows keyless entry and start performance.₤ 200 - ₤ 500

The Replacement Process

Step-by-Step Guide to Replacing a Clio Key

Step 1: Determine Key TypeRecognize the kind of key you presently have for your Clio. This guide has actually provided initial clarity, but if you're unsure, speaking with the user handbook or a dealership can assist.

Action 2: Check Your WarrantyBefore proceeding, confirm if your warranty covers key replacements. Depending on the manufacturer's policies and the age of your automobile, you might have more choices than you realize.

Action 3: Contact a Dealer or LocksmithWhen you've identified how to progress, contact either a licensed Renault dealer or a certified locksmith professional. If selecting a locksmith professional, make sure they focus on automobile keys.

Step 4: Provide Necessary DocumentationBe prepared to present identification, your lorry registration, and, if possible, a copy of your initial key. This paperwork ensures that your request is genuine and legitimate.

Step 6: Test Your New KeyNo matter how you acquired your new key, constantly check its functionality. Make sure that it can both lock/unlock the car and, if applicable, begin the engine.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)

1. How much does it cost to replace a Renault Clio key?The total cost can differ considerably depending on the kind of key, whether you go through a dealership or locksmith, and the specific rates in your region. Expect to pay in between ₤ 10 for a conventional key to ₤ 500 for a clever key.

2. Can I program a new key myself?The process can be complicated and typically depends on your design year. While some older designs allow DIY programming, more recent keys normally need customized equipment.

3. How long does key replacement take?The time can vary from a fast 30 minutes with a locksmith professional to a number of days if purchased through a dealership, specifically if the dealership needs to source the key.

4. What should I do if I lose my only key?If you discover yourself in this situation, you'll need to seek advice from a dealer or locksmith to replace the key. They may require your lorry identification number (VIN) to begin the procedure.

5. Is insurance protection readily available?Some insurance plan might cover lost key replacements. Constantly consult your insurance coverage service provider to comprehend your coverage alternatives.
